Abstract

Latar Belakang : Epilepsi merupakan gangguan neurologis kronis yang ditandai dengan kejang berulang akibat aktivitas listrik abnormal pada otak. Perbedaan etiologi dan manifestasi klinis dapat menyebabkan perbedaan prioritas diagnosis keperawatan sehingga diperlukan asuhan keperawatan yang individual. Tujuan: Mendeskripsikan pelaksanaan asuhan keperawatan pada pasien dengan diagnosis medis epilepsi di RSUD Ulin Banjarmasin. Metode: Penelitian ini menggunakan desain studi kasus deskriptif pada dua pasien dengan diagnosis medis epilepsi selama 3×24 jam. Data dikumpulkan melalui wawancara, observasi, pemeriksaan fisik, dan studi dokumentasi, kemudian dianalisis secara deskriptif berdasarkan proses keperawatan. Hasil: Hasil pengkajian menunjukkan adanya perbedaan kondisi klinis pada kedua pasien. Tn. S dengan riwayat stroke iskemik memiliki prioritas diagnosis Penurunan Kapasitas Adaptif Intrakranial, sedangkan Tn. M dengan kejang berulang memiliki prioritas diagnosis Risiko Cedera. Intervensi keperawatan mengacu pada SDKI, SIKI, dan SLKI sesuai kondisi masing-masing pasien. Setelah implementasi selama 3×24 jam, pada Tn. S tidak ditemukan tanda perburukan neurologis selama masa observasi, sedangkan pada Tn. M tidak terjadi cedera selama masa perawatan meskipun sempat mengalami satu episode kejang. Kesimpulan: Asuhan keperawatan yang disesuaikan dengan kondisi klinis pasien mendukung pencegahan komplikasi dan meningkatkan keselamatan pasien selama perawatan. Background: Epilepsy is a chronic neurological disorder characterized by recurrent seizures resulting from abnormal electrical activity in the brain. Variations in etiology and clinical manifestations can lead to differences in nursing diagnosis priorities, necessitating individualized nursing care. Objective: To describe the implementation of nursing care for patients with a medical diagnosis of epilepsy at Ulin Regional General Hospital (RSUD), Banjarmasin. Methods: This study employed a descriptive case study design involving two patients diagnosed with epilepsy, monitored over a period of 3×24 hours. Data were collected through interviews, observations, physical examinations, and document reviews, then analyzed descriptively based on the nursing process. Results: Assessment results revealed differences in the clinical conditions of the two patients. Mr. S, with a history of ischemic stroke, had a priority nursing diagnosis of Decreased Intracranial Adaptive Capacity, whereas Mr. M, who experienced recurrent seizures, had a priority diagnosis of Risk for Injury. Nursing interventions were based on SDKI, SIKI, and SLKI standards, tailored to each patient's condition. Following the 3×24- hour implementation period, Mr. S showed no signs of neurological deterioration, while Mr. M sustained no injuries during the care period, despite experiencing a single seizure episode. Conclusion: Nursing care tailored to the patient's clinical condition supports the prevention of complications and enhances patient safety during treatment. Keywords: nursing care, epilepsy, decreased intracranial adaptive capacity, risk for injury
